Exactly how Regularly Should You Take Your Pet Dog To The Veterinarian in Nottingham UK?

Normally, if you have a healthy canine, it would only need to visit you local Nottingham vet at least once every 12 months for a general appointment. It is fairly different for new puppies as well as older dogs.

New puppies will certainly require numerous visits to the vet in their initial 6 months. They will certainly require to visit the vet for their first exam, pup vaccinations, heartworm (plus flea and tick) prevention, and also for neutering. Whilst, senior pets over 7 years will need at the very least two checkups annually.

What Are The Different Types of Animal Hospitals in Nottingham UK?

Put simply, a vet is essentially an animal physician. There are lots of types of vets in Nottingham UK however listed below are the 5 primary types of vets.

Companion pet veterinarians: Veterinarians that deal with companion pets like dogs and also cats.

Livestock vets: Vets that work with tamed stock.

Exotic animal veterinarians: Vets that generally work with reptiles, birds and tiny mammals like rodents and also ferrets.

Mixed practice veterinarians: Veterinarians who work with both small and big pets.

Lab animal medicine vets: Veterinarians who operate in labs that are in charge of the wellness of a variety of pets on account of scientific research.

Animal Vaccinations

Just like humans, regular or yearly vaccinations for dogs as well as felines are required for good health and wellbeing. Shots for pet cats and also pets will safeguard your pet from potentially serious and deadly health issues. Local veterinarians in Nottingham UK can recommend you to obtain a custom preventative health care plan for your animal, which has routine animal vaccinations. No matter your dogs breed or cats breed, vaccinations are important.

Common diseases consisting of parvovirus, hard pad disease, contagious canine hepatitis, as well as canine coughing can be prevented by inexpensive yearly shots for canines.

FVRCP shots for cats and various other vaccinations for felines will ensure long-term immunity towards infectious as well as preventable diseases.

Emergency Vet Solutions for Pet Dogs

Not all vets nearby Nottingham have emergency situation vet services for animals. Call your neighborhood Nottingham vet initially to see if they offer emergency situation vet solutions. A few of the a lot more common reasons you might require to bring your family pet to an emergency situation veterinarian in Nottingham UK consist of:

  • Vomiting blood
  • Abrupt change in breathing
  • Crawler or serpent bites
  • Extreme coughing
  • Straining to urinate or eliminate waste
  • Collapsing
  • Paralysis
  • Consumption of poisonous substance
  • Trauma (e.g. from getting struck by an auto, battling an additional animal, diminishing porch and so on)
  • Anything causing serious discomfort.


Cat and Dog Oral Cleaning and Exams

Regular oral cleansing and also examinations on your cats and pets will certainly help to identify any indicators of oral condition and also will certainly allow your Nottingham vet to review what oral monitoring program would certainly be best for your feline or pet. Typical signs of oral condition in pet dogs and cats consist of foul breath, loose teeth, discoloured teeth, face swelling, extreme salivating as well as much more.
